Output fa85cbb38a15012a3247aec76c268d63538683945036daf41ffece35aaa74bed:0

value
17332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21fff321ddf3d4a04c3fb4e930bffd161f12e289 OP_EQUALVERIFY OP_CHECKSIG
address
146mv2jEjrgfoGwNJba9Q562VSWnsKDM6N
transaction
fa85cbb38a15012a3247aec76c268d63538683945036daf41ffece35aaa74bed
confirmations
203290
spent
true